Core Insight:
According to Osho, stop letting the mind’s doubt keep you wavering; decide with the heart and trust. Meditation and devotion are two doors to the same house—self-remembering and God-remembering—and whichever you choose, the other will follow. Begin anywhere, but begin now, and stay with it long enough for roots to take hold; trust is what truly carries you.
Don’t overthink; choose the path your heart prefers—quietly remembering your own divinity or lovingly seeing the divine in all—trust it, start today, and keep going.
